The guided tour of LEGOLAND Discovery Center San Antonio was Lana’s favorite part of the day! The San Antonio mini land display was an incredible model of the downtown area. This 1.5 million brick display included LEGO boats floating along the miniature River Walk and an interactive recreation of the Alamodome complete with moving players and working videoboards. Lauren’s highlight from the downtown adventure was the City Sightseeing Hop-On-Hop-Off Double Decker Bus Tour! This bus tour is fun even on a hot day in Texas. Sitting on the upper deck allows you to feel a nice breeze and soak in the views with an informative, entertaining lesson, and occasional song from your driver/tour guide.
